Sutter Medical Group seeks to hire a highly qualified and passionate Pediatric Critical Care Medical Director for Sutter Medical Center Sacramento Children’s Center to lead and oversee the clinical operations and strategic programmatic growth of the PICU/CVICU. This role partners closely with hospital administration and multidisciplinary teams to advance patient safety, clinical quality, operational effectiveness, and the strategic vision of pediatric inpatient services.

 

Practice Setting:

Our pediatric intensivists provide care for a diverse and medically complex pediatric population including a robust complex congenital heart disease cardiovascular surgery division and award winning ECMO program within a 20-bed general PICU/CVICU located in a tertiary care children’s center.

 

The center also includes:

  • 40-bed general pediatric unit
  • Northern California’s largest NICU
  • Robust newborn nursery service
  • Dedicated Pediatric Emergency Department
  • Physicians work closely with a comprehensive complement of pediatric medical and surgical subspecialists, supported by a multidisciplinary team including social work, integrative medicine, pediatric pharmacy, and other pediatric-focused services.

Organization Details

Sutter Medical Group (SMG) is a vibrant and talented community committed to delivering safe, affordable and high-quality care. Our multi-specialty medical group is comprised of over 1,600 clinicians practicing in seven counties in northern California, most within a 50-mile radius of Sacramento.
